Sri Surdas Maharaj – Sri Sur – Vinaya – Pathrika-Chapter – 21 - All Jeevas are bound by the sufferings and grief of worldly existence like the crocodile

Sri Surdas Maharaj speaks “ Oh! Prabho, you can’t bear to watch your devotees in distress, you are an ocean of mercy, when the Gajendra was caught on the leg by a crocodile in the pond, he was left alone by family, relatives, and companions, he miserably failed to pull out the leg from the mouth of the crocodile, finally, he remembered you. Oh! Prabho, you did not wait too long, rushed on your feet to protect your devotee Gajendra, leaving behind Sri Vaikundam, Goddess Sri Mahalakshmi, and your celestial vehicle Garuda, thus Gajendra got rid of the sufferings and pain of several years instantly. In this way, whenever your devotees are met with hardships, you have rushed to protect them and kept your promise alive. Your child devotee Prahladha desired your presence in the pillar, you have appeared before him in the form of Nrisimha. Devi Draupadi was humiliated in the large assembly of Kaurava, none could protect her from the disgrace, she cried out calling your names for help was protected from further humiliation. Oh! Prabho, you have pleased your sincere devotee Vidura, and accepted his hospitalities, leaving behind the extravagant meal arranged by the Kauravas. In the kali era, your passionate devotee Santh Namadeva achieved your compassionate grace, Oh! Prabho, I am a helpless Bhramin like Sudhama, you have showered an abundance of grace on your childhood companion Sudhama and removed his poverty, kindly shower your grace upon me too.”


Jaise Thum Gaja Kau  Pau Chudayau | Apane Jan Kau Dhukhith Jani Kai Pau Piyadhe Ghayau || Jaha Jaha Gad Pari Bhakthani Kau  Thaha Thaha Aapu Janayau | Bhakthiheth Prahladha Ubarayau Dhraupadhi Cheer Bdayau|| Preethi Jani Hari Gaye Bidhura Kai Namadheva Ghar Cchayau | Surdasa Dhvija Dheena Sudhama Thihi Dharidhra Nasayau ||
